With just a few days left before Polaris 26 kicks off, the preliminary card has now been finalised with the last five matches confirmed. First up is a BJJ blue belt Franck Takoudjou who comes all the way from Cameroon, courtesy of the Francis Ngannou Foundation. He's one of the top prospects competing in the UK right now and he will be facing one of his biggest challenges yet in Gracie Barra Top Team's Archer Colaco. Takoudjou's coach and the founder of the BJJ program at the Francis Ngannou Foundation, Sam Crook, will also be competing at Polaris 26. Crook faces Mike Parry in an exciting rematch between two veteran black belt competitors. UFC veteran Phil Harris is returning to the Polaris mats too, and he'll be facing off against another experienced competitor in Mark Phung. Harris isn't the only man with Polaris experience competing on the preliminary card either, as Justin Moore returns to face Mathew Fitz-James. That match is sure to deliver plenty of action too, as both men are known for their exciting styles. The full main card lineup for Polaris 26 has been finalised, with the last match rounding out the event and adding even more excitement. The final main card match will see Polaris Contenders winner Marcin Maciulewicz returning after a valiant effort at the Polaris Absolute Grand Prix. He looked incredible at the Polaris Contenders tournament but had the bad luck of drawing reigning ADCC world champion Giancarlo Bodoni in the opening round of the grand prix. Although Maciulewicz was submitted, that match was a huge step up in competition and he still remains one of the top grapplers in Europe. Maciulewicz will be facing Max Bickerton, the head coach of one of the top no gi grappling gyms in the UK. Although Bickerton is busy bringing on the next generation of talent at Grapple Collective, he's also a Polaris veteran who is coming off a slick submission win in his last appearance. It's a great matchup between two top talents where both men will be eager to find the finish and make a huge impression on the biggest show in Europe.
